This is not even close to HK’s Honeymoon Dessert chain from which it seems to be an off-shoot of. I should know…I lived in HK for over 2 decades before relocating back to Canada recently.

We excitedly wondered if this really was the brand from HK initially, with the similar name (one character is different in Chinese), the same iconic yellow serving plates, bowls and spoons, etc. But after our experience, we wondered if this was just a poor excuse for a copycat brand that cheaps out on ingredients.

The two desserts we ordered (mango pomelo tapioca with grass jelly and sesame walnut paste with glutinous sesame balls) were incredibly bland. There was little sweetness and for the most part, lacked flavour (we could make out the sesame and walnut flavours if we really tried hard looking out for it). The grass jelly was sparse and the mango pomelo tapioca was flavourless. The glutinous sesame balls tasted okay, but the mochi exterior was incredibly thick (I’d say about 2-3x the normal thickness) so it was just an exercise of chewing excessively to finish it.

We kept wondering and joking about why the restaurant was full and people kept coming in. Maybe there’s a lack of alternatives for HK-style desserts?

I will say one good thing though, if you’re on a low-sugar diet and craving dessert, this is a place to check out…because you’re going to taste nothing.
